Kazuya Nakai

Voice Actor

Kazuya Nakai is a veteran Japanese voice actor best known worldwide as Roronoa Zoro in One Piece. In My Hero Academia he brings his gravelly delivery to Flect Turn, the ideologically driven villain who challenges the heroes in the World Heroes' Mission arc.

My Hero Academia Role

Nakai voices Flect Turn, an activist turned villain who orchestrates a terrorist plot targeting heroes across the globe in My Hero Academia: World Heroes' Mission and the anime's fifth season. The character frames himself as a twisted savior of humanity, using extremist logic to justify mass violence, and Nakai leans on his trademark rasp to sell the villain's cold conviction. It marked a rare theatrical villain lead for an actor whose career has largely been built on swaggering heroes and antiheroes rather than antagonists.

Career and Notable Roles

Nakai has voiced action-anime leads since the mid 1990s, most famously spending over two decades as Roronoa Zoro in One Piece and lending his voice to Toshiro Hijikata in Gintama, Date Masamune in the Sengoku Basara franchise, and Mugen in Samurai Champloo. His other credits range from Shinjiro Aragaki in the Persona franchise to Jin Sakai's Japanese-language performance in the video game Ghost of Tsushima, and he took home a Best Supporting Actor prize at the 2011 Seiyu Awards for his One Piece and Gintama work.
